Esempio n. 1
0
function drawSelectInter($menu)
{
    $interval = $_SESSION['MenuInterval'];
    $select = $_SESSION['selectedInter'];
    $iselect = selectIndex($interval['opt'], $select);
    $selected = min($iselect, $interval[$menu]);
    for ($i = 0; $i <= $interval[$menu]; $i++) {
        $val = $interval['opt'][$i][0];
        $txt = tr($interval['opt'][$i][1]);
        $sel = '';
        if ($i == $selected) {
            $sel = "selected='selected'";
        }
        echo "<option value=" . "'" . $val . "' " . $sel . ">" . $txt . ' </option>' . "\n";
    }
}
Esempio n. 2
0
                $_SESSION['datebeg'] = $date0;
                $_SESSION['dateend'] = $date1;
            }
        }
    }
}
if (isset($_GET['row'])) {
    $row = $_GET['row'];
    $date_beg = $_SESSION['date_beg'];
    $date_end = $_SESSION['date_end'];
    $sel = selectIndex($opt, $interval);
    if ($sel < maxIndexMenu('G')) {
        $beg = $_SESSION['begdata'];
        $dateRow = $beg + $row * $inter;
        $interval = $opt[$sel + 1][0];
        $sel = selectIndex($opt, $interval);
        $inter = $opt[$sel][2];
        $tinter = $opt[$sel][1];
        $date_beg = $dateRow - 50 * $inter;
        $date_end = $dateRow + 50 * $inter;
        $date_end = min($date_end, time());
        $datebeg = date("d/m/Y", $date_beg);
        $dateend = date("d/m/Y", $date_end);
        $_SESSION['selectedInter'] = $interval;
        $_SESSION['datebeg'] = date("d/m/Y", $date_beg);
        $_SESSION['dateend'] = date("d/m/Y", $date_end);
        $_SESSION['date_beg'] = $date_beg;
        $_SESSION['date_end'] = $date_end;
    } else {
        $numrows = ($date_end - $date_beg) / $inter;
        $rowBeg = max(0, $row - $numrows / 10);